Immediate Steps After an Injury
Prioritize Your Health
Your health must come before any legal action—even if you feel “fine” at first. Some injuries, like spinal injuries, may not show symptoms immediately. Getting prompt care creates an legal record linking your condition to the incident. A Atlanta personal injury attorney can later use this to prove damages. Delaying treatment only helps the insurance company question your claim.
- Visit a hospital, clinic, or specialist right away
- Notify your doctor the injury was accident-related

Am I too late to start a personal injury claim in Georgia?
The legal time limit for most personal injury claims is two years from the date of the accident, which applies to cases handled by a motorcycle accident lawyer. Failing to act in time can result in inability to recover damages, so it’s crucial to contact a licensed attorney Georgia as soon as possible.
Some exceptions may shorten or extend this period—especially in government-related injury cases—so getting a free case review ensures you don’t miss key deadlines. A experienced Atlanta injury law firm will help you meet all legal requirements on time.

Can I still get compensation if car crash with mutual responsibility?
Yes, Georgia follows a shared fault rule, meaning you can still recover official source damages as long as you are under 50 percent. For example, if you’re found 30% responsible, your award is reduced by that percentage—a insurance payout of $100,000 becomes $70,000.
